Dublin Stall Front with Feed Opening
Dublin stall fronts are an excellent portable or permanent horse stall solution. Constructed of hot-dip galvanized steel, for rust protection and have hidden interior welds to avoid burrs. Extremely versatile and solid for open span barns. The feed opening allows you to grain and supplement horses from your aisle. A great solution for open span barns or arena stalls – temporary to permeant stalling.

Dublin stall fronts are an excellent portable or permanent horse stall solution. This horse stall allows for good ventilation and socialization. One touch tear drop track and trolley, rather than round, is self cleaning. Dublin horse stalls are hot-dip galvanized steel for rust protection and feature hidden interior welds without burrs.
Length: 10′ or 12′ (Custom sizes available upon request.)
Finish: Hot-Dip Galvanized
Channel Gauge: 14-gauge
Frame Gauge: 2″ x 2″ 14-gauge
Door Gauge: 1-3/4″ x 1-3/4″ 14-gauge
Bar Gauge: 16-gauge
Full Grill Door Bottom Bars Gauge: 14-gauge
Bar Spacing: 3-1/4″
Bar Diameter: 7/8″
Bar Height: 33″
Door Width: 51-1/2″
Door Opening Width (Standard): 48″
Door Height: 80-3/8″
Floor to Top of Header: Top of Front = 84″, Top of Front with Track Piece = 85-3/8″
Floor to Bottom of Bars: 48-5/8″
Latch Type: Up Latch
Post: Door Stop (*Varies by layout.)
Guide: Door Stay
Track: 8′ Premium Track
Wood Direction: Vertical (*Note: Wood lumber is not included in the kit; we recommend tongue and groove wood for all of our horse stall systems. )

Installation: This is a freestanding horse stall system; no support posts are required for this installation. Connect the stall panels with stall connectors, which are sold separately and can be found here. *Note: Wood lumber is not included; we recommend tongue and groove wood for all of our horse stall systems.
